What to do if your four and a half month old baby has red and swollen lower eyelids

In addition to symptomatic medication for children's red and swollen eyelids, they should also pay attention to eye hygiene and wipe them with a clean, warm towel. In addition, towels should be disinfected frequently by washing them in hot water and then drying them in the sun.

There are many specific reasons for the redness and swelling of the baby's eyelids, such as stye, conjunctivitis, keratitis, inflammation, trauma, etc. Different causes require different treatment methods, so you must go to a regular medical institution for examination and then use symptomatic medication for treatment.

If the redness and swelling is caused by a stye, there will be obvious red and swollen bumps on the eyelids, and the baby will also feel pain. If there are no bumps but only redness, it may be keratitis, which can be treated with anti-inflammatory and bactericidal eye drops, and it can be completely cured in three to five days.

The patient feels itchy and burning eyes and the skin at the eyelid margin becomes red. This is mostly due to blepharitis, also known as "sore eye margins" or "red eye margins".

When waking up in the morning, the upper and lower eyelids are often stuck with a large amount of sticky or purulent secretions. There is a foreign body sensation or burning sensation in the eyes, and slight tearing or pain. Most of them are acute infectious conjunctivitis, commonly known as "pink eye" or "fulminant red eye".

The eyes have obvious irritation symptoms, such as fear of light, tearing, pain, decreased vision, and grayish white or yellowish white ulcers on the surface of the cornea, which are mostly keratitis.
